If you get an email similar to the one below, do not click on the link. It
is a phishing email and leads to a different site that is designed to look
like the web site of Fidelity Homestead.

The good news, if you are using Internet Explorer 7 and have activated the
phishing filter, it will alert you that is a phishing site.

To help the bank trace the source of this email, forward the entire email to
spoof at fidelityhomestead.com
